Understanding the Duty of a Business Electrician
Business electricians play an important function in the building and construction, upkeep, and fixing of electric systems in commercial buildings. Unlike domestic electrical experts who focus on homes and apartment or condos, industrial electricians manage companies, manufacturing facilities, warehouses, and other massive facilities. Their work makes certain that these establishments operate smoothly and securely, sticking to all essential codes and criteria.
Among the primary obligations of a commercial electrical expert is to install electrical systems for new structures. This involves reading blueprints and collaborating with architects and professionals to figure out the most effective format for electric wiring, lighting fixtures, and equipment. Business electrical experts have to recognize with numerous electric codes and regulations to make certain every installment is certified and secure, which can vary substantially by area.
In addition to installation, commercial electrical contractors are also responsible for preserving and repairing existing electric systems. This might include repairing problems with lights, outlets, or machinery that call for electrical power. They utilize specialized tools and equipment to identify and take care of problems, reducing downtime for services that rely on their electric systems for day-to-day procedures. Ensuring that these systems remain functional is important for preserving efficiency and safety and security within the workplace.
Another essential element of a commercial electrical contractor’s work is the capacity to work with a range of systems. This consists of anything from standard lights and electrical circuits to complicated machinery and high-voltage systems. Commercial electricians need to continually enlighten themselves on the latest innovations and developments to stay up to date with the advancing demands of the industry. They may likewise deal with renewable resource systems, such as photovoltaic panels, making them an important part of contemporary business facilities.
